Q1a =>The Haber process is used to synthesize ammonia (NH3) on a large scale by the reaction of nitrogen gas with hydrogen gas as follows: N₂ (g) + 3 H₂ (g) ---> 2 NH3 (g) Consider a reaction between a 1.6 L flask containing nitrogen gas and a 16.1 L flask of hydrogen gas. Both gases have a temperature of 300 K and the pressures inside both flasks is 1 bar. What mass of ammonia (in g) would you expect to be produced at temperature 300 K and a pressure of 1 bar? Q1b=> What is the average kinetic energy (in kJ mol-¹) of a hypothetical gas with molecular weight 82.1 g mol¹ at a temperature of 83.4 °C? Do not try to identify the gas.
